What is the Job Fact Sheet for Biomedical Media Technician?
The Job Fact Sheet (JFS) for the Biomedical Media Technician outlines the essential components of the role, capturing vital information that aids in employee management. This document serves as a foundational tool for defining job responsibilities, expectations, and the organizational structure associated with the position.
Key elements of the JFS include job identification, which helps establish a clear reference point, along with sections detailing key work activities and an organizational chart that provides visual context. Employees and supervisors each play a critical role in completing the form to ensure it remains accurate and reflective of current job functions.

Key Features and Sections of the Job Fact Sheet for Biomedical Media Technician
The JFS consists of several sections, each serving a specific purpose to support effective workforce management. The form includes a job summary, which provides a broad description of the role, alongside detailed segments outlining key work activities and the necessary signature requirements for completion.
Spaces for user input feature prominently on the form, with blank fields and checkboxes designed to capture relevant information. This structured approach not only facilitates collaboration between employees and supervisors but also ensures that all critical details are systematically recorded for future reference.
